Wax Ester Synthesis under Aerobic and Anaerobic Conditions in Euglena gracilis

In Euglena gracilis distribution of radioactivity from labeled acetate into cellular components was quite different under aerobic and anaerobic conditions, and a large part of it was found in wax esters in anoxia. Wax ester synthesis from acetate was immediately stimulated about 30 times by transfer of the cells into anaerobiosis, and reversed result was shown by back to aerobiosis. Similar observations were made with labeled myristic acid, but radioactivity of labeled myristyl alcohol was incorporated solely into wax esters both in aerobiosis and anaerobiosis. The activity of reduction from fatty acids to alcohols in cell-free extract was hardly changed when the cells were transferred into anaerobiosis.
